Histology slide preparation is a essential step in the analysis of tissues. A well-prepared slide delivers a clear and accurate representation of the tissue organization, allowing for in-depth interpretation by pathologists and researchers. Mastering these techniques guarantees optimal slide quality and subsequently accurate investigative outcomes.

Several factors influence slide preparation, including the type of tissue, fixation methods, processing steps, embedding procedures, sectioning techniques, and staining protocols.

Precise attention to detail at each stage is indispensable for achieving a high-quality slide.

  • Proper tissue fixation preserves the morphology of cells and tissues, preventing degradation and autolysis.
  • Removal of Water prepares the tissue for embedding in paraffin wax, ensuring consistency of the final sections.
  • Cutting thin slices of the embedded tissue is essential for microscopic examination.

Dyeing techniques enhance the visibility of cellular structures and components, allowing for recognition of specific features.

Continuous practice, attention to detail, and adherence to established protocols are key to mastering histology slide preparation techniques.

Preclinical Histology Lab Services: Cost Breakdown

Determining the exact cost of preclinical histology lab analyses can be a involved process. Various factors influence the final quote, including the extent of the study, the volume of samples required, and the degree of histochemical analysis needed.

Typical expenses associated with preclinical histology lab services include sample handling, sectioning, staining, visualization, image capture and archiving. Furthermore, some labs may have additional fees for specialized techniques, such as immunohistochemistry or in situ hybridization.

Precise and Optimal Histology Slide Preparation for Research

In the realm of histological research, the preparation of slides is paramount to ensure accurate and reliable results. A meticulously crafted slide provides a clear and detailed view of tissue structures, look what i found enabling researchers to investigate cellular morphology, identify pathological changes, and obtain valuable insights into various biological processes. Efficient slide preparation techniques are crucial for minimizing artifacts and maximizing the quality of microscopic observation.

The process involves a series of sequential steps, starting with tissue fixation to preserve its structure. Subsequently, tissues undergo dehydration, clearing, and embedding in paraffin wax or other suitable media. Thin sections are then sliced using a microtome and mounted on glass slides.

Following mounting, the slides are processed through staining procedures that highlight specific cellular components. Hematoxylin and eosin (H&E) is a widely utilized stain for routine histological examinations, providing contrasting coloration to nuclei and cytoplasm. Other specialized stains can be used to target particular structures or molecules of interest.

  • Furthermore, proper slide labeling and storage are essential for maintaining data integrity and facilitating future examination.
